What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Australian Cattle Dog / Blue Heeler mixed breeds are typically best suited for active households that can provide plenty of physical and mental stimulation. They thrive in homes with access to a secure yard and owners who enjoy outdoor activities.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
This breed has high energy levels and benefits from regular exercise in a fenced yard or safe, open areas. Apartment living is possible if owners are committed to providing daily vigorous walks and playtime.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Australian Cattle Dog mixes can do well with children, especially if raised with them and properly socialized. Their herding instincts may make them naturally watchful, but positive training ensures they are wonderful family companions.
